Innovative, startlingly perceptive and aglow with colour, these fifteen stories were written towards the end of Katherine Mansfield's tragically short life. Many are set in New Zealand, others in England and the French Riviera.

Acclaimed stories by the influential Modernist author include Prelude, a reminiscence of her New Zealand girlhood, in addition to The Garden Party, Marriage a la Mode, Bliss, and others.

The letters included in this volume cover the 18 months Mansfield spent in England, France and Switzerland, from May 1920 until the end of 1921. It is the period which saw some of her finest work.

This new selection of Mansfield's stories adds 6 stories to Dan Davin's original selection of 27 and arranges them in the order in which they first appeared, in the definitive text established by Anthony Alpers.
